Superloop has launched a new Superloop AI billing system project as part of its ongoing push to expand artificial intelligence and automation across its operations. The telecommunications provider is working to modernise its billing infrastructure and replace several legacy platforms. The project forms part of a broader technology transformation aimed at simplifying operations and supporting continued business growth.

Superloop has chosen Aria Systems to supply the new billing platform. The company will implement Aria Billing Cloud to manage billing and rating processes. The platform will support multiple service categories, including consumer broadband, enterprise connectivity, wholesale services, and white-label products.

Modernising Billing Infrastructure with the Superloop AI Billing System

Superloop has experienced rapid expansion since it was founded in 2014. The company now delivers broadband, mobile, and network connectivity services across Australia. Growth has occurred through organic expansion and acquisitions.

Over time, Superloop built several internal billing platforms. These systems were developed on different technologies and operated independently. The situation created duplicated functions and increased operational complexity.

The Superloop AI billing system project aims to replace these fragmented tools with a unified cloud-based platform. Aria Billing Cloud will serve as the central environment for billing operations across all business segments.

The Software-as-a-Service platform will support billing processes for residential customers, enterprise clients, and wholesale partners. The goal is to standardise billing operations and reduce system management complexity.

AI and Data Capabilities in the Superloop AI Billing System

The new platform includes tools designed to support data analytics and artificial intelligence capabilities. The Superloop AI billing system will integrate with the company’s existing AI-enabled infrastructure. The system is expected to assist with automation and improved internal data analysis.

Aria Billing Cloud provides monetisation and usage-processing features. The platform uses the Allegro usage processing engine to manage complex billing structures. These functions allow the system to handle subscription-based billing and usage-based charging models.

The billing platform is designed to support evolving telecommunications service models and product offerings.

Business Growth Driving the Superloop AI Billing System Project

Superloop has reported strong financial growth in recent years. The company recorded about 31 percent annual revenue growth in 2025. Its network and connectivity services now support hundreds of thousands of homes and businesses across Australia.

The Superloop AI billing system project is intended to support this growth by simplifying billing operations and improving scalability. Consolidating systems into a single cloud platform is expected to remove duplication and streamline processes across the organisation.

The initiative will support billing operations across consumer, enterprise, and partner markets while enabling further automation within Superloop’s technology environment.
